Lines Matching refs:isa
424 static std::string GetApexDataDalvikCacheDirectory(InstructionSet isa) { in GetApexDataDalvikCacheDirectory() argument
425 if (isa != InstructionSet::kNone) { in GetApexDataDalvikCacheDirectory()
426 return GetDalvikCacheDirectory(GetArtApexData(), GetInstructionSetString(isa)); in GetApexDataDalvikCacheDirectory()
432 InstructionSet isa, in GetApexDataDalvikCacheFilename() argument
438 std::string apex_data_dalvik_cache = GetApexDataDalvikCacheDirectory(isa); in GetApexDataDalvikCacheFilename()
457 std::string GetApexDataOatFilename(std::string_view location, InstructionSet isa) { in GetApexDataOatFilename() argument
458 return GetApexDataDalvikCacheFilename(location, isa, /*encode_location=*/false, "oat"); in GetApexDataOatFilename()
461 std::string GetApexDataOdexFilename(std::string_view location, InstructionSet isa) { in GetApexDataOdexFilename() argument
462 return GetApexDataDalvikCacheFilename(location, isa, /*encode_location=*/true, "odex"); in GetApexDataOdexFilename()
480 InstructionSet isa, in GetApexDataDalvikCacheFilename() argument
483 dex_location, isa, /*encode_location=*/true, file_extension); in GetApexDataDalvikCacheFilename()
490 static void InsertIsaDirectory(const InstructionSet isa, std::string* filename) { in InsertIsaDirectory() argument
494 CHECK_NE(pos, std::string::npos) << *filename << " " << isa; in InsertIsaDirectory()
496 filename->insert(pos + 1, GetInstructionSetString(isa)); in InsertIsaDirectory()
499 std::string GetSystemImageFilename(const char* location, const InstructionSet isa) { in GetSystemImageFilename() argument
503 InsertIsaDirectory(isa, &filename); in GetSystemImageFilename()